I have an old room thermostat TR2 , was fitted by BG along with the RD532i combi boiler ( worcester bosch Benchmark type ), do i need to replace the thermostat for an exact same make & model ( TR2 ) or can I replace with a more accurate LED display type ?? ( new TR2 seem's to be approx £100 , expensive for a room stat ! )
 
No it doesn’t have to be like for like. Safely remove the cover of the thermostat 1st to check how many wires are inside, I’ve known them to be 2 wire, which you would be better suited to a 2 wire thermostat. This is to keep temperature swings at bay.

Please do not remove the cover on the boiler unless you’re a suitably qualified engineer (gas safe in the uk) as this forms part of the combustion circuit.
 
Honeywell 6360b as you might not have a neutral at the stat
